What AI Voice Pioneers Actually Teaches
The 16 courses span 434 modules, and they’re split cleanly between building and earning. On the technical end you get natural language processing fundamentals, tool selection, conversation UX design, testing, and deployment. The NLP groundwork matters here, and the way the program structures it lines up with how research groups frame the field (see Stanford’s overview of natural language processing). On the business end, it covers positioning, outreach, and the client-acquisition systems that turn a working agent into paid work. It’s a lot of material. The volume is the point, but it’s also the thing to be aware of before you commit.
The Pioneer Path: From Beginner to Client-Ready in ~30 Days
The Pioneer Path is the spine of AI Voice Pioneers. It’s a day-by-day track of 84 videos designed to move a complete beginner to a client-ready voice developer in roughly 30 days. We like that it’s sequenced rather than dumped.
Who AI Voice Pioneers Is For
This is built for entrepreneurs, freelancers, agencies, and consultants who want to add voice agents to what they sell. If you’re already running an AI automation agency on the back of something like Corbin Brown’s Start a Successful AI Automation Agency and shipping voice bots daily, a chunk of the early modules will be review. And if you only want to tinker for a hobby and never touch a client, the heavy client-acquisition half is wasted on you. It fits best for people who can build and intend to sell. The breadth that makes it strong also makes it a poor match for someone who wants one narrow skill and nothing else.
